Abstract: Tensor polarization t20 of the deuteron is calculated on the basis of a hybrid quarkhadron model. A relativistic wave function of the deuteron is used to calculate the relativistic impulse approximation and the contribution of the ρπγ meson exchange process. Good agreement with experimental data is achieved when and only when the ρπγ coupling constant is taken as positive.
